From: Matthew Wilcox (Oracle) Date: Wed, 2 Oct 2024 15:25:29 +0000 (+0100) Subject: ksm: convert should_skip_rmap_item() to take a folio X-Git-Url: https://www.infradead.org/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=76f1a8261188dfbc46d2957e2bb98dd5f007da7c;p=users%2Fjedix%2Flinux-maple.git ksm: convert should_skip_rmap_item() to take a folio Remove a call to PageKSM() by passing the folio containing tmp_page to should_skip_rmap_item. Removes a hidden call to compound_head().
